103-year-old Julia Hawkins popularly known as Hurricane the flower girl from Louisiana - US State, won a gold medal in a 50-meter dash

Julia won the gold medal in the 50-meter race at the Senior Games in Albuquerque, held in New Mexico on Monday.

The old and energetic woman completed the race in just 21.06 seconds, setting a new record, for there is no other woman in the said category with the stunning record.

According to the KRQE report, Julia had earlier, two years ago, set a record in the 100-meter dash, where she won by crossing the finishing line in less than 40 seconds, setting up a world record that is yet to be broken.

After the Monday gold medal, she extended her winning culture in the 100-meter dash one day later, which she also won, but could not break her earlier record. She finished the race in more than 46 seconds.

“I thought it would be neat to run at 100 and do the 100-yard dash,” Julia says.

The family of the former teacher revealed that she ventured into athletics when she was as old as 101 years old.

Unlike most runners including Kenyans, Julia does not practise in the fields, she practises by taking care of her trees in the garden.

“I have an acre of land and I have 50 kinds of trees, and I’m working on them all the time,” adds Julia.

She also revealed that she runs to inspire people because it is the running that keeps her body in good health and a mind sharp.

“I hope I’m inspiring them to be healthy and to realize you can still be doing it at this kind of age,” she concluded.
